SUNY Westchester Community College Workstation Engineer II in Valhalla, New York

Location: Valhalla, NY Category: Staff Positions Posted On: Wed Jan 10 2024 Job Description:

Under general supervision, an incumbent of this position is responsible for the installation, maintenance and relocation of workstations and associated peripheral equipment. Incumbents may be assigned to any departmental work shift and provide support services to various departments. This class differs from the Workstation Engineer I in that the Workstation Engineer II is involved in project planning and systems integration issues; managing and configuring "enterprise" level tools which have an impact on county-wide operations and not single entities; and managing projects from beginning to end, rather than elements of a project. This class is further distinguished from Workstation I by the level of independence exercised in the performance of work assignments, complexity of these assignments as well as the advanced level of troubleshooting involved in finishing an assignment. The incumbent also regularly leads and guides other staff in the performance of more specialized assignments. While guidance and leadership is provided, supervision is not a responsibility of this class. Does related work as required.

Job Requirements:

RE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S: This is a Civil Service position. The final candidate will be required to take and pass the Civil Service Exam.

The successful candidate must possess a high school or equivalency diploma and either:

  • A Bachelor's degree in Information Technology or a closely related field, and three years of experience where a primary function of the position was the installation, operation, maintenance and diagnosis of workstation problems and associated equipment; OR

  • Eight years of experience as described in where a primary function of the position was the installation, operation, maintenance and diagnosis of workstation problems and associated equipment.

NOTE: The satisfactory completion of 30 credits may be substituted on a year for year basis for up to four years of the required experience. A Master's Degree in Information Technology or a closely related field may also be substituted for one additional year of experience.

The successful candidate must also possess a valid license to operate a motor vehicle in the State of New York at time of appointment and maintain same while in the title.
